Auto Create
Components on Insulation Run at Interval
Configure this constraint to automatically create multiple components at intervals along insulation runs.

| Argument | Description |
|---|---|
CopyOther Component |
Use to specify the component type you want to create. Default entry is Other Component. Click to display a list of available components. Choose from Other Component or Spot Tape. |
CopyPart Number/Code |
Use to configure various ways to specify the part number for the component you want to auto create. Note If the component type you have selected to auto create is Spot Tape, a popup menu displays to choose from all valid Object Type Information spot tape insulation codes. Click the argument to display a popup menu: Edit or New — Opens the Text Expression Dialog Box, to create or edit a query expression to drive the selection of the part number. In the Text Expression dialog box, click the Advanced Editor button (), to open the Edit Query Expressions Dialog Box and create or edit advanced queries. Queries are scoped to Insulation Run. Part Selection — Opens the Part Selection Dialog Box to set a specific part number to use. If the component type is Other Component, you can select any group components from the Value dropdown list. A predefined query from the list. See “Query Expression Context” to filter items in the list. |
Copy<any> |
Use to specify a query expression condition to drive the selection of the associated matching object. Click the text to open a popup menu: Edit or New — Opens the Condition Dialog Box, to create or edit a query expression. In the Condition dialog box, click the Advanced Editor button (), to open the Edit Query Expressions dialog box and create or edit advanced queries. See also “Query Expressions”. {any} — Click to apply to all matching objects. Select a predefined query from the list. See “Query Expression Context” to filter items in the list. |
Copy0.0 |
Use in a range to specify lengths to drive the selection of the bundle or insulation runs, and to specify position interval / offset values for component placement: Length — Minimum / maximum values for bundles or insulation runs. If values are 0.0, the process considers all. Offset — From junctions or ends. Interval —Spacing along the bundle or insulation. |
CopyCenter Point |
The location from which the auto placement will apply intervals: Center point — Center of the bundle where the components will be created first. Start — Start of the insulation run. End — End of the insulation run. |
Examples
This constraint example places spot tape with part number SPOT-PET-19 at 60 mm intervals from the center point of all slit tubes.
